Knight Frank Group is looking for a cybersecurity professional to monitor security events and coordinate incident responses. The ideal candidate will have at least 3 years of relevant experience in security operations, with strong analytical and documentation skills. Familiarity with tools like Microsoft Defender and experience in vulnerability management are essential.
